Key Responsibilities of a Cyber Security Analyst
Cyber security analysts wear many hats, and their daily tasks can vary widely depending on the size and nature of their organization. However, some core responsibilities remain consistent across the board. Monitoring networks and systems for security breaches is a fundamental task. This involves using various security tools and technologies to detect suspicious activity and potential threats. Analysts must be vigilant and proactive in their monitoring efforts, as even a small lapse in attention can lead to a major security incident. Another crucial responsibility is investigating security alerts and incidents. When a security alert is triggered, analysts must quickly assess the situation, determine the scope and severity of the incident, and take appropriate action to contain the damage. This may involve isolating infected systems, blocking malicious traffic, and restoring data from backups. Moreover, cyber security analysts are responsible for conducting security assessments and vulnerability scans. This involves using specialized tools to identify weaknesses in systems and applications that could be exploited by attackers. Analysts must then prioritize these vulnerabilities and work with other IT teams to implement remediation measures. Implementing and maintaining security tools, such as firewalls, intrusion detection systems, and anti-virus software, is another key responsibility. Analysts must ensure that these tools are properly configured and up-to-date, and that they are effectively protecting the organization's assets. Furthermore, they play a vital role in developing and implementing security policies and procedures. This involves working with management and other stakeholders to create a framework for security that is aligned with the organization's business objectives. Analysts must also ensure that these policies and procedures are communicated to employees and that they are followed consistently. Essential Skills for a Cyber Security Analyst
To thrive as a cyber security analyst, you need a diverse skill set that combines technical expertise with analytical and problem-solving abilities. Technical skills are the foundation of your expertise. A deep understanding of networking concepts, operating systems (Windows, Linux, macOS), and security technologies (firewalls, intrusion detection systems, anti-virus software) is essential. You should also be proficient in scripting languages like Python or PowerShell, which can be used to automate tasks and analyze data. Analytical and problem-solving skills are equally important. You must be able to analyze large amounts of data, identify patterns, and draw conclusions about potential security threats. You should also be able to think critically and creatively to develop solutions to complex security problems. Furthermore, communication skills are often overlooked but are crucial for success. You must be able to communicate technical information clearly and concisely to both technical and non-technical audiences. You will often need to explain complex security issues to management, employees, and even customers. In addition to these core skills, other valuable assets include: knowledge of security frameworks and standards (e.g., NIST, ISO 27001), experience with security auditing and compliance, and familiarity with cloud computing environments (AWS, Azure, GCP). The ability to stay up-to-date with the latest security threats and trends is also critical, as the threat landscape is constantly evolving. Continuous learning and professional development are essential for staying ahead of the curve. Consider pursuing certifications such as Certified Information Systems Security Professional (CISSP), Certified Ethical Hacker (CEH), or CompTIA Security+ to demonstrate your expertise and enhance your career prospects. Career Paths for Cyber Security Analysts
The career path for a cyber security analyst can be incredibly diverse and rewarding, offering opportunities for growth and specialization. Many analysts start in entry-level roles, such as security operations center (SOC) analysts or junior security analysts. These positions provide valuable experience in monitoring networks, investigating security alerts, and responding to security incidents. As you gain experience and expertise, you can move into more senior roles, such as security analyst, senior security analyst, or security engineer. In these positions, you will have more responsibility for designing and implementing security solutions, conducting security assessments, and leading incident response efforts. Furthermore, you can also specialize in a particular area of cyber security, such as penetration testing, vulnerability management, incident response, or forensic analysis. These specialized roles require deep technical knowledge and expertise in a specific area of security. Another career path for cyber security analysts is management. You can move into roles such as security manager, security director, or chief information security officer (CISO). In these positions, you will be responsible for leading and managing a team of security professionals, developing and implementing security strategies, and ensuring that the organization's security posture is aligned with its business objectives. Additionally, cyber security analysts can also pursue careers in consulting. Security consultants work with organizations to assess their security posture, identify vulnerabilities, and recommend security solutions. This can be a challenging but rewarding career path, as you will have the opportunity to work with a variety of organizations and help them improve their security. The Future of Cyber Security Analysis
The future of cyber security analysis is bright, but it is also fraught with challenges. As technology continues to evolve and the threat landscape becomes increasingly complex, cyber security analysts will play an even more critical role in protecting our digital world. One of the biggest trends shaping the future of cyber security analysis is the increasing use of artificial intelligence (AI) and machine learning (ML). These technologies can be used to automate tasks, analyze large amounts of data, and identify patterns that would be impossible for humans to detect. However, AI and ML also present new challenges for cyber security analysts. Attackers are increasingly using AI and ML to develop more sophisticated attacks, so analysts must be able to understand and defend against these threats. Another trend is the growing importance of cloud security. As more organizations move their data and applications to the cloud, cyber security analysts must be able to secure these environments. This requires a deep understanding of cloud computing concepts, security technologies, and best practices. Furthermore, the rise of the Internet of Things (IoT) is also creating new security challenges. IoT devices are often insecure and vulnerable to attack, so analysts must be able to identify and mitigate these risks. This requires a broad understanding of IoT technologies, security protocols, and vulnerability assessment techniques.
